Martin A. Skrevet 28. juni 2005 Rapporter Del Skrevet 28. juni 2005 Hei Prøver nå å få til mySQL, og brukte pakken som følger med slack. Jeg skrev følgende: su - mysql mysql_install_db Og regna med at det var det. Startet den på måten som sto etter at "mysql_install_db" var ferdig(cd /usr ; /usr/bin/mysqld_safe). Og så skulle jeg lage passord. mysql@localhost:/tmp$ mysqladmin -u root password ******* mysqladmin: connect to server at 'localhost' failed error: 'Can't connect to local MySQL server through socket '/var/run/mysql/mysql.sock' (2)' Check that mysqld is running and that the socket: '/var/run/mysql/mysql.sock' exists! Jeg skulle da tro den funker, da jeg både har prøvd på en restart. Både med init-scriptet, og måten jeg skrev tidligere. Ettersom jeg finner en god del mysqld-prosesser når jeg skriver "ps aux". Det viste seg også nå, at '/var/run/mysql/mysql.sock' ikke eksisterte. Nå skjønner jeg altså ingenting her, og håper at noen her kan strekke ut en hjelpende hånd Mvh, Martin Lenke til kommentar
objorkum Skrevet 28. juni 2005 Rapporter Del Skrevet 28. juni 2005 Er slik med alle Slackware-installasjonar, i alle fall dei eg har hatt med MySQL. Hugsar ikkje korleis eg fiksa det då, sjekka loggar, brukte fornuften osv, men søkte litt på Google og fann: chown -R mysql:mysql ln -s /var/lib/mysql/mysql.sock /tmp Så kan du starte MySQL... Lenke til kommentar
Martin A. Skrevet 28. juni 2005 Forfatter Rapporter Del Skrevet 28. juni 2005 Det funka ikke helt slik du skrev, men søkte etter "chown -R mysql:mysql" i google, og kom frem til denne siden: http://www.slackwarehelp.org/post-1053.htm...3a6873b07952e43 mysql@localhost:~$ chown mysql /var/lib/mysql/* mysql@localhost:~$ chown mysql /var/lib/mysql/mysql/* mysql@localhost:~$ ln -s /var/run/mysql/mysql.sock /tmp/mysql.sock mysql@localhost:~$ su Password: root@localhost:/var/lib/mysql# /etc/rc.d/rc.mysqld start root@localhost:/var/lib/mysql# Starting mysqld daemon with databases from /var/lib/mysql root@localhost:/var/lib/mysql# su mysql mysql@localhost:~$ mysqladmin -u root password ******* m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user: 'root@localhost' (Using password: NO)' Nå burde det jo egentlig fungere, men som dere ser, så gjør det jo ikke det. Lenke til kommentar
objorkum Skrevet 28. juni 2005 Rapporter Del Skrevet 28. juni 2005 Ver root i terminalen først, og prøv: mysql -p Prøv først med tomt passord, prøv så med root-passordet. Lenke til kommentar
Martin A. Skrevet 28. juni 2005 Forfatter Rapporter Del Skrevet 28. juni 2005 Da får jeg logget inn et sted jeg ikke aner hva er. Men jeg får fortsatt ikke til å lage en database mysql@localhost:~$ mysqladmin create sitestat m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user: 'root@localhost' (Using password: NO)' Lenke til kommentar
objorkum Skrevet 28. juni 2005 Rapporter Del Skrevet 28. juni 2005 Da får jeg logget inn et sted jeg ikke aner hva er.Men jeg får fortsatt ikke til å lage en database mysql@localhost:~$ mysqladmin create sitestat m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user: 'root@localhost' (Using password: NO)' (Using password: NO) Du må angi passord. mysqladmin -p create sitestat Lenke til kommentar
olear Skrevet 28. juni 2005 Rapporter Del Skrevet 28. juni 2005 Slackware MySQL Howto su su mysql mysql_install_db exit sh /etc/rc.d/rc.mysql start mysqladmin -u root password 'new-password' Lenke til kommentar
Anbefalte innlegg
Opprett en konto eller logg inn for å kommentere
Du må være et medlem for å kunne skrive en kommentar
Opprett konto
Det er enkelt å melde seg inn for å starte en ny konto!
Start en kontoLogg inn
Har du allerede en konto? Logg inn her.
Logg inn nå